Finance Information Systems Manager
Hiring Department
ERP Project
Job Description
University of Missouri Controller’s Office provides leadership in the planning, integration, financial reporting and tax compliance for the University across all campuses and the health system. Collectively with campus colleagues, we serve as a strategic and trusted advisor, and pursue continuous improvement through knowledge, collaboration and leadership.
A successful candidate for this position in the Controller’s Office will: Thrive in a fast-paced environment; Demonstrate knowledge of a broad range of financial functions, procedures, and processes; Be self-motivated and proactively solve problems with little oversight; Work well as a member of a team and provide leadership and motivation; Understand the relationships between financial statements and systems that feed them; Proactively communicate problems and work across the enterprise to solve them.
The Finance Information Systems group maintains the University of Missouri’s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) Financial Systems and is responsible for the technology processes and functions that impact transactional processing, data reconciliation, reporting, system maintenance, and upgrades. The group provides functional expertise to design the new cloud ERP system that will be implemented by the University.
Reporting to the Director – Finance ERP, this position is responsible for the full record-to-report set of modules in the University’s new cloud ERP system including but not limited to: General Ledger, Financial Reporting, Endowments, Payroll Accounting, Assets, Banking, Customer Accounts, and Budgeting. Over a period of three years, the University will be implementing a new cloud ERP. This will be one of the first positions on the project and will first lead data readiness work for financial reporting before transitioning into the implementation of the new software.
Key Responsibilities
- Prior to implementation, consolidate and improve reporting infrastructure to ensure comparable legacy data exists at go live.
- Leads the resources responsible for the record to report portion of the ERP implementation.
- Manages the vendor relationship with the implementation partner to ensure all business requirements are identified and implemented.
- Actively engages stakeholders in decision-making related to both system and process design.
- Exercises judgment and applies perspectives based on the analysis of multiple sources of information.
- Works with project manager to lead key project elements.
- Develops tests plans and advises implementation and technology partners on system design.
- Plans for necessary resources within the record to report sub teams.
Shift
Monday - Friday, 8am-5pm, some after hours and weekends as needed.
Minimum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ree or equivalent combination of education and experience, and five years of relevant experience.
Preferred Qualifications
A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Business, Accounting, or a related field. Proficient with data management, reporting and enterprise software applications. Certified Public Accountant designation. Experience in ERP technology solutions, processes, and integrations. Strong accounting skills. Strong analytical and organizational skills. Ability to prioritize and be self-motivated. Experience directing teams and processes preferred.
Anticipated Hiring Range
Salary Range: $105,000.00 - $120,000.00 per year Grade: GGS 012 University Title: ERP Pillar Lead
